💬What is Wolfoo Escape?
Wolfoo Escape keeps things simple: you're a cartoon wolf cub who has to reach a glowing door at the end of each side-scrolling stage. The obstacles are standard platformer fare—gaps, raised ledges, maybe the occasional moving block—but the level design has a nice rhythm. One moment you're chaining three jumps in a row without breaking stride, the next you're standing at a ledge trying to eyeball whether that far platform is actually reachable or just there to mock you.
I'll admit I misjudged a jump on an early level because Wolfoo's sprite makes him look smaller than his actual collision box. You clip a corner, slide off, and have to start the stage over. That's not a bug; it just means you have to aim your landings a little tighter than you'd think. The controls are responsive enough—arrow keys or A/D to move, Space/Up/W to jump—and after a couple deaths you start to feel the timing. On mobile, the on-screen left, right, and jump buttons do the job, though touch input can feel slightly less precise for the tighter gaps.
It's clearly aimed at younger players who know Wolfoo from the cartoons, but the difficulty doesn't insult anyone. Some of the later jumps require actual patience, which kept me coming back for one more attempt. The glowing door is always visible, so you always know where you're headed. 👥How to Play Wolfoo Escape
Desktop: Arrow keys or A / D to move, Space / Up / W to jump.
Mobile & touch: use the on-screen Left, Right and Jump buttons.
Reach the glowing door to finish each level.
✨Game Tips
Jump from the very edge of a platform—Wolfoo's leap distance is generous, but only if you don't leave early.
Tap the jump button a split second before reaching a gap on mobile to compensate for touch latency.
Keep an eye on the glowing door; it's usually placed so you can plan two or three jumps ahead.
If a landing feels too far, it probably is. Look for a lower ledge or an alternate route first.
Use short hops for single-block gaps and save full jumps for wide pits.
